This is how I would draw the Sixth Doctor and Commander Maxil, both played by Colin Baker… if the fact that they look the same WASN’T the joke XP
Their characters are quite different, and normally I would prefer to draw people played by the same person like so. Notably, Maxil is more simplistic and conservative, making square angles fit him better. Six has a more diverse range of emotions, per his status as protagonist and Maxil’s as a supporting, one-note one. Thus, his more flexible face and complicated hair.
